45:28-1 Definitions relative to scrap metal businesses.

1. As used in this act:
"Scrap metal" means used, discarded, or previously owned items that consist predominantly of ferrous metals, aluminum, brass, copper, lead, chromium, tin, nickel, or alloys, and shall include a used catalytic converter, in whole or in part, if the used catalytic converter is not attached to a motor vehicle.
"Scrap metal business" means a commercial establishment which, as one of its principal business purposes, purchases scrap metal for purposes of resale or processing.
L.2009, c.8, s.1; amended 2023, c.56, s.1.
